Assume SnowTown T-Shirt company has $8,000 value of unsold t-shirts leftover from the end of final yr. The clothing company then spends one other $80,000 in direct labor, direct supplies, and manufacturing overhead to provide extra t-shirts during the yr. At the end of the current 12 months, the corporate is left with $10,000 value of unsold t-shirts. Calculating The Current And Future Worth Of An Annuity https://beryl-labs.co.za/calculating-the-current-and-future-worth-of-an/ Thu, 04 Sep 2025 19:22:10 +0000 https://beryl-labs.co.za/?p=2886 When calculating future values, one component of the calculation known as the long run value factor. The future value factor is the aggregated development that a lump sum or collection of money circulate will entail. For example, if the longer term worth of $1,000 is $1,a hundred, the lengthy run value issue will have to have been 1.1. A future worth issue of 1.0 means the worth of the series will be equal to the worth at present.

The present value of an annuity is based on an idea often identified as the time worth of money. This idea suggests that the money you have now is worth greater than the money that you’re promised tomorrow. Future worth, on the other hand, represents what an annuity might be price later and it accounts for the ability of compounding curiosity. Amortization schedules are given to debtors by a lender, like a mortgage company. They define the funds wanted to pay off a loan and how the portion allotted to principal versus interest changes over time. A manufactured good is an efficient that is produced primarily by the appliance of labour and capital to raw materials and other intermediate inputs. As such, manufactured items are the alternative of main goods, but include intermediate goods in addition to final goods. They include metal, chemical compounds, paper, textiles, machinery, clothes, vehicles, and so on. An imprest petty money system means the petty cash float is restored to a onerous and fast amount on a daily basis. For instance, if the float is $100, when cash is spent and the stability falls under $25, the float is replenished back to $100.
